Jadon Sancho Seals Aston Villa Loan Move as Manchester United Exit Confirmed

Jadon Sancho has finally secured his Manchester United exit after Aston Villa agreed a deadline day loan deal that will see the England international spend the 2025/26 season at Villa Park. The move represents a crucial lifeline for the 25-year-old winger, whose Old Trafford career has stalled dramatically since his £73 million arrival in 2021.

Deal Structure Offers Fresh Start for Sancho

The agreement between the Premier League clubs sees Aston Villa commit to paying a loan fee plus covering 80% of Sancho’s substantial wages throughout the season-long stint.

Manchester United retain the option to extend the player’s contract by an additional year beyond its current expiration in summer 2026, protecting their asset’s value.

Jadon Sancho Loan Deal DetailsTerms
Loan DurationSeason-long (2025/26)
Villa Wage Contribution80% of salary
Loan FeeUndisclosed
United Contract Option+1 year extension
Medical StatusTo be completed

The structured arrangement allows Villa to secure a proven Premier League talent without committing to Sancho’s full wage packet, while United maintain control over his long-term future.

Romano Confirms Transfer with Trademark “Here We Go”

Transfer specialist Fabrizio Romano delivered his famous “Here We Go” confirmation, stating: “Jadon Sancho to Aston Villa, here we go! Deal in place on initial loan from Manchester United. Green light from United and deal being sealed with formal steps to follow next.”

The Italian journalist’s endorsement signals that all major obstacles have been cleared, with only medical examinations and final paperwork remaining before Sancho’s official unveiling as a Villa player.

Villa Beat Competition for Sancho’s Signature

Aston Villa emerged victorious in the race for Sancho after the winger rejected multiple overseas approaches throughout the summer. AS Roma had lodged a formal offer that United were prepared to accept, but Sancho turned down the Italian giants in favor of remaining in English football.

Turkish powerhouse Besiktas also explored a potential swoop, though their advances were similarly rebuffed by the England international, who demonstrated clear preferences for staying in familiar surroundings.

Summer Interest in SanchoOutcome
AS RomaPlayer rejected approach
BesiktasPlayer rejected approach
Tottenham HotspurInterest reported
Aston VillaDeal agreed

Following Rashford’s Successful Villa Path

The loan move mirrors Marcus Rashford’s successful stint at Villa Park during the second half of last season, where the England forward rediscovered his form under Unai Emery’s guidance. Rashford’s renaissance at Villa ultimately secured him a move to Barcelona and a return to the England national team setup.

Sancho will hope to replicate this trajectory, using Villa’s European platform and Emery’s coaching expertise to revitalize his career after a disappointing loan spell at Chelsea yielded just three goals and four assists in 31 appearances.

Emery’s Track Record with Struggling Stars

Unai Emery’s proven ability to rehabilitate underperforming talents makes Villa an ideal destination for Sancho’s career reset. The Spanish manager has consistently extracted maximum value from players seeking fresh starts, with his tactical flexibility perfectly suited to accommodate Sancho’s skillset.

Villa’s recent 3-0 home defeat to Crystal Palace highlighted their need for additional attacking creativity, with Emery identifying wide reinforcement as a priority before the transfer deadline. Sancho’s arrival addresses this deficiency while providing the manager with a player capable of operating across multiple forward positions.

United’s “Bomb Squad” Exodus Continues

Sancho’s departure represents the latest exit from Manchester United’s so-called “Bomb Squad” – a group of players deemed surplus to requirements by manager Ruben Amorim. The summer clearout has seen Marcus Rashford join Barcelona, Alejandro Garnacho move to Chelsea, Rasmus Hojlund depart for Napoli, and Antony secure a Real Betis switch.

This systematic squad overhaul reflects Amorim’s determination to reshape United’s playing personnel, with Sancho’s loan providing temporary relief from his substantial wage commitment while maintaining future transfer options.

Champions League Football the Key Factor

Villa’s Champions League qualification proved instrumental in convincing Sancho to accept the move, with the prospect of European football representing a significant attraction. The winger has been vocal about his desire to play at the highest level, making Villa’s continental participation a crucial factor in negotiations.

The timing also works perfectly for both parties, with Villa requiring immediate attacking reinforcement and Sancho needing regular first-team opportunities to rebuild his reputation ahead of potential England recalls.

Medical and Formalities to Complete Transfer

With agreements reached between all parties, attention now turns to completing the standard medical examinations and finalizing contractual paperwork. Sources suggest these formalities should be concluded swiftly, allowing Sancho to integrate with Emery’s squad before Villa’s next fixtures.

Jadon sancho to join aston villa

The loan structure provides both clubs with flexibility, offering Villa a proven Premier League performer without permanent commitment while allowing United to reassess Sancho’s long-term value based on his Villa Park performances.

Villa fans will hope Sancho’s arrival can provide the attacking spark that has been missing in their opening fixtures, with the England international bringing pace, creativity, and Premier League experience to Emery’s European campaign.

FAQs

How much are Aston Villa paying for Jadon Sancho’s loan?

Villa will pay an undisclosed loan fee plus cover 80% of Sancho’s wages throughout the season-long deal.

Can Aston Villa make the move permanent?

While no automatic purchase option has been confirmed, Manchester United hold a contract extension option that could facilitate future permanent discussions.

Why did Sancho choose Villa over other interested clubs?

Sancho rejected offers from AS Roma and Besiktas, preferring to remain in English football with Champions League qualification being a key factor in choosing Villa.

How did Sancho perform at Chelsea last season?

Sancho managed three goals and four assists in 31 appearances during his Chelsea loan, with the Blues ultimately paying £5m to avoid their purchase obligation.

What position will Sancho play at Aston Villa?

Emery’s tactical flexibility means Sancho could operate in various forward positions, likely starting on the wing but with potential for central attacking roles depending on team needs.
